YouTube AI Lip-Sync and Auto-Dubbing 2026: Innovation or Voice Theft?

IMPORTANT CLARIFICATIONS

  • The Lip-Sync Pilot: YouTube is testing a new AI feature to align a creator’s lip movements with the dubbed audio track.
  • Voice Ownership: Amidst the rollout, creators are raising alarms over “Voice Cloning” without explicit consent.
  • Requesting Removal: YouTube has introduced a new tool to request the takedown of AI content that simulates your unique voice.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)

  • Can I turn off the auto-dubbing feature on my channel?
    Yes, creators can opt-out of the pilot via the “Language & Audio” settings in YouTube Studio.
  • Does YouTube AI lip-sync work for all languages?
    Currently, it is being tested in major languages like Spanish, Portuguese, and Hindi, with more 2026 updates planned.
  • How do I report a voice-cloned video?
    Use the “Privacy Complaint” tool specifically updated for “AI-generated likeness” under the 2026 guidelines.
